Introduction to Sand Blasting
Sand blasting is a highly effective surface preparation and cleaning process widely used in construction, manufacturing, metal fabrication, and concrete surface finishing. In this process, abrasive materials are propelled at high speed using compressed air or mechanical force to clean, smooth, roughen, or shape a surface. We use sand blasting to remove rust, paint, dirt, corrosion, oil stains, and old coatings from different surfaces such as concrete, steel, brick, and stone.
Sand blasting is also known as abrasive blasting, and it plays a critical role in surface preparation before painting, coating, or sealing. The process ensures better bonding of paint and coatings, increasing durability and lifespan of structures.
What Is Sand Blasting
Sand blasting is a surface treatment process in which abrasive particles are blasted onto a surface at high velocity using compressed air or a blasting machine to clean or modify the surface texture.
The abrasive materials used in sand blasting include:
- Silica sand
- Steel grit
- Glass beads
- Aluminum oxide
- Garnet sand
- Copper slag
The selection of abrasive material depends on surface type, required finish, and cleaning intensity.
Sand blasting is commonly used for:
- Concrete surface cleaning
- Rust removal from steel
- Paint removal
- Surface roughening
- Graffiti removal
- Industrial equipment cleaning
- Bridge and building maintenance
Sand Blasting Process Step by Step
Surface Preparation
We first clean the surface to remove oil, grease, and loose particles before blasting.
Abrasive Loading
Abrasive material is loaded into the blasting machine or sand blasting pot.
Air Compression
Compressed air is generated using an air compressor which creates high pressure.
Blasting Operation
The abrasive particles are forced through a nozzle at high speed and directed onto the surface.
Surface Finishing
After blasting, the surface becomes clean, rough, and ready for coating or repair work.
Concrete Sand-Blasting Equipment
1. Air Compressor
The air compressor is the main component that generates high-pressure air required for blasting operations. The compressor capacity depends on nozzle size and pressure requirements.
2. Sand Blasting Machine / Blasting Pot
This machine stores abrasive material and mixes it with compressed air before blasting. It includes:
- Pressure vessel
- Control valves
- Abrasive metering valve
- Moisture separator
3. Blasting Hose
Heavy-duty rubber hoses carry abrasive and compressed air mixture from the blasting pot to the nozzle.
4. Blasting Nozzle
The nozzle increases the velocity of abrasive particles. Nozzles are usually made of:
- Tungsten carbide
- Boron carbide
- Silicon carbide
5. Protective Equipment
Safety equipment is very important in sand blasting operations:
- Helmet with air supply
- Safety gloves
- Protective suit
- Safety goggles
- Respirator mask
Types of Sand Blasting
Dry Sand Blasting
This is the most common method where dry abrasive particles are blasted using compressed air.
Wet Sand Blasting
Water is mixed with abrasive material to reduce dust and heat generation.
Vacuum Sand Blasting
A vacuum system collects dust and used abrasive materials during blasting.
Pressure Sand Blasting
High-pressure blasting is used for heavy cleaning and industrial applications.
Micro Abrasive Blasting
Used for delicate surfaces and precision cleaning work.

Sand Blasting for Concrete Surface
Concrete sand blasting is used to:
- Remove laitance layer
- Remove old paint and coatings
- Expose aggregate finish
- Clean oil stains
- Prepare surface for epoxy coating
- Surface roughening before plaster
- Decorative concrete finishing
Concrete sand blasting improves bond strength between old and new concrete surfaces.
Safety Precautions in Sand Blasting
Safety is very important during sand blasting work.
Important safety measures include:
- Use protective helmet and air supply
- Wear safety gloves and suit
- Use dust mask or respirator
- Ensure proper ventilation
- Do not blast in closed area without ventilation
- Check hose and nozzle before operation
- Maintain proper air pressure
- Use moisture separator in compressor line
Difference Between Sand Blasting and Shot Blasting
| Sand Blasting | Shot Blasting |
|---|---|
| Uses compressed air | Uses centrifugal force |
| Uses sand or abrasive particles | Uses steel shots |
| Used for cleaning and finishing | Used for surface strengthening |
| Portable equipment | Heavy machinery |
| Used for concrete and metal | Mostly used for steel surfaces |
